Output 75406b61ae5f6d5603a2e3030c1d4e024fff8f2994d723d0de306721b526ab29:2

value
21322236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537f0e77e8d4f548aec6c419175b07b7993bcd29 OP_EQUAL
address
MFWeXPndhVioyd7EzTNWvJ86oQnkRTAsVv
transaction
75406b61ae5f6d5603a2e3030c1d4e024fff8f2994d723d0de306721b526ab29
spent
true